Position Summary:


Rutgers, The State University of New Jersey is seeking a Program Coordinator for the Outpatient Services Department within Rutgers University Behavioral Health Care.
The primary purpose of the Program Coordinator is to work in collaboration with Program Manager, and to function as a member of the clinical and administrative leadership team in the Outpatient Services Coordinated Specialty Care (CSC) Program. Primarily responsible for providing community outreach and education, interface with potential individuals served, supervision to multi-disciplinary staff and providing direct services to individual within the CSC impacted by psychosis. Will ensure compliance with all regulations.
Among the key duties of this position are the following:
  • Provides staff with direction regarding consumer/patient intervention through individual supervision, group supervision, team meetings, and case conferences.
  • Monitors staff performance and at minimum, on a bi-annual basis, meets individually with assigned staff to review performance goals, and compliance with mandatory continuing education requirements.
  • Facilitates weekly team meetings to review cases, communicate supervisory updates, and program developments.
  • Effectively contributes to and supports an environment that respects and enhances the individual, their expressed choices and preferences, and that enhances the positive self image of consumer/patients and staff.
  • Closely monitors program compliance with all licensing and regulatory requirements.
  • As required by individual program, assumes direct care responsibilities for consumer/patients and provides comprehensive initial assessments, individual, group, family therapy, supportive counseling, crisis intervention, psycho-education, and case management services as clinically indicated.
  • Monitors staff compliance with all documentation requirements on a consistent basis via documentation reports, supervisory tools and chart review.

Minimum Education and Experience:

  • Master's Degree in a related mental health discipline plus four (4) years of post-master's mental health experience.

Physical Demands and Work Environment:


Physical Demands: Ability to walk throughout the day, stand for extended periods of time, and focus on assigned tasks in a hectic noisy environment.
Work Environment: Varied work settings include office and community setting. May be exposed to infectious and contagious diseases. Subject to varying and unpredictable situations. Handles emergency or crisis situations. May be exposed to clients exhibiting assaultive or aggressive behaviors. Quiet to moderately loud office setting.

About Rutgers University
Rutgers, The State University of New Jersey, is a leading national public research university and the state's preeminent, comprehensive public institution of higher education. Rutgers is dedicated to teaching that meets the highest standards of excellence; to conducting research that breaks new ground; and to turning knowledge into solutions for local, national, and global communities. As it was at our founding in 1766, the heart of our mission is preparing students to become productive members of society and good citizens of the world. Rutgers teaches across the full educational spectrum: preschool to precollege; undergraduate to graduate and postdoctoral; and continuing education for professional and personal advancement. Rutgers is New Jersey's land-grant institution and one of the nation's foremost research universities, and as such, we educate, make discoveries, serve as an engine of economic growth, and generate ideas for improving people's lives.
